Skip to content

Releases: Hendrix-Shen/MagicLib

MagicLib 0.8.633

14 Oct 12:06
eddde66
Compare
Choose a tag to compare

Fixes

  • Fix ConfigContainer::isSatisfied faulty logic again (#114)

Full Changelog: 0.8-patch.1...0.8-patch.2

[CI#501]MagicLib 0.8.633+eddde66

14 Oct 08:04
eddde66
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

Fix ConfigContainer::isSatisfied faulty logic again (#114)

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

MagicLib 0.8.632

14 Oct 05:41
f45fe2d
Compare
Choose a tag to compare

Features

  • Impl setMaxUpStep compat (MC 1.20.5+)
  • Support MC 1.21.1
  • Update malilib extra things
    • Port comment modifier features from tweakermore
    • Adding debug option for configmanager
  • Add EntityTypeRestriction for malilib
  • Add ConfigVec3i & ConfigVec3iList for malilib
  • Add platform type to dependency check & platform api update (#111)
  • Fix ConfigContainer::isSatisfied faulty logic (#113)

Fixes

  • Fix ModListAdapter causing crashes (forge-like)
  • Fix entrypoint dependency check logic

Development

  • Migrate to NyanMaven, drop MavenCentral
  • Break Change: Modify compatible module method names to recognize vanilla methods
  • Disable AccessWideners & interfaceInjection transitive
  • No longer publish snapshot
  • Add a shortcut to BlockStateCompat
  • Add ResourceLocationCompat::parse

New Contributors

Full Changelog: 0.8...0.8-patch.1

[CI#498]MagicLib 0.8.632+f45fe2d

13 Oct 11:54
f45fe2d
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

Fix ConfigContainer::isSatisfied faulty logic (#113)

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

[CI#494]MagicLib 0.8.629+1c0a956

13 Oct 08:04
1c0a956
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

Misc dependency update (#112)

  • Update dependencies:modloader to latest

  • Update dependency fabric-api to latest

  • Update dependency modmenu to latest


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

[CI#490]MagicLib 0.8.628+4857a7d

10 Oct 14:19
4857a7d
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

Add platform type to dependency check & platform api update (#111)

  • Support for PlatformTypes as dependency check condition

  • Update Mixin Dependency check

  • Reimplement getNamedMappingName api (forge-like)

  • Fix crash caused by FML changes

  • Update ReflectionUtil

  • Add CommonUtil

  • Make VersionUtil::isVersionSatisfyPredicate public

  • Fix getNamedMappingName impl (forge)

  • Break changes with ModListAdapter (forge)

  • Use Reflection to adapt to Minecraft Forge 1.17 changes
  • Minecraft Forge 1.20.5+ always uses mojmap
  • But if you set it to yarn via architectury-loom, it's undetectable!
  • Fix crash with getNamedMappingName (neoforge)

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

[CI#458]MagicLib 0.8.619+2bccdb8

19 Sep 06:53
2bccdb8
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

Separate ListEditEntryButtonType from WidgetVec3iListEditEntry

and use our i18n text

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

[CI#453]MagicLib 0.8.615+8e4153f

07 Sep 04:45
8e4153f
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

Remove accidental words

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

[CI#449]MagicLib 0.8.612+e7b3c25

05 Sep 08:46
e7b3c25
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

com.github.johnrengelman.shadow 8.1.1 -> com.gradleup.shadow 8.3

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top

[CI#447]MagicLib 0.8.609+a6a71ae

19 Aug 17:33
a6a71ae
Compare
Choose a tag to compare
Pre-release

This version is automatically released by CI Build

Latest commit log:

omg x 3

Signed-off-by: Hendrix-Shen HendrixShen@hendrixshen.top